Images Subcategories- Folders Image-Management
I greatly enjoy employing lots of images and and carousels, as I'm sure plenty other users do. But as my collection has expanded, my list of folders has grown too long. In fact, I've had to group images up far too generally which makes it difficult to set a carousel for some articles (ex: all of my nonhuman species are in a single file).
Being able to create subcategories or files would make it more feasible to sort out images of specific characters, species, cultures, landscapes, etc and make better use of carousels. It would also make it easier to sort new images if these files are collapsible. Having to scroll through an extensive list of folders when assigning new images is time consuming when uploading a lot of pictures.
As an example, being able to place all characters under one folder while still keeping each character in their own file/carousel would be more ideal than having one seemingly endless garble of all characters in one file or having a far too extensive list of files to shuffle through!
